Discover top Prague (and vicinity) attractions

The greater Prague area offers a wealth of attractions perfect for families and luxury seekers alike, making it an enticing spot for those considering all-inclusive hotel options. Start your adventure at Prague Castle, a UNESCO World Heritage site, where you can explore stunning gardens and breathtaking views of the city. Just a short distance away, the historic Charles Bridge invites leisurely strolls amidst its baroque statues, perfect for capturing memorable family photos. For those seeking a touch of nature, the sprawling Petřín Hill boasts a beautiful park and a lookout tower reminiscent of the Eiffel Tower, providing a fun climb for children and a romantic view for couples. Don’t miss the vibrant atmosphere of Old Town Square, where you can witness the iconic Astronomical Clock show and enjoy local street performances. Finally, the nearby town of Kutná Hora, famed for its Bone Church, offers a unique day trip filled with intriguing history. When's the best time for an all-inclusive stay in Prague?
There's nothing like an all-inclusive holiday in Prague to rejuvenate you, especially when you know what to expect from the elements. Here's some information to help you choose when to book: The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 2°C. February and March are the driest months, while June and August are the rainiest months.
What's the best way to get to Prague and explore the area?
With plenty of transportation options, planning your time in Prague is simple. Walk to nearby metro stations such as Namesti Republiky Station, Náměstí Republiky Stop and Mustek Station. The closest major airport is Vaclav Havel Airport (PRG), which is located 7.1 mi (11.5 km) from the city centre.
